chili berry sorbet

Spread the love

Ingredients for 2 servings:

  • 250 g natural yogurt 0.1% fat
  • 1 tbsp desiccated coconut
  • 150 g berries, fresh or frozen (e.g. blueberries, strawberries, currants, also cherries)
  • 1 tbsp honey or diet sugar

Instructions

Working time approx. 10 minutes; Rest time approx. 2 hours; Total time approx. 2 hours 10 minutes

dessert

Pour the berries into a bowl and blend until smooth. Add the yogurt, 3/4 of the tablespoon of desiccated coconut, and the honey, and mix well (do not over-blend!). Pour into molds and freeze for about 2 hours, extending the freezing time if necessary. Serve garnished with one or two berries and the remaining desiccated coconut. A delicious dessert for hot summer days, and a great way to keep your figure healthy! (new) ww-pp = 2 per serving.
